Output 80f933727cae37a57fd25cb62a456289a39e4a3cfcd876a8c78a89f6f2d15736:0

value
1847280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ff1e3a67a3b70449ac20340ba8280459de057a OP_EQUAL
address
3JC3AzGCQ4wGa7qKex9scJaUANSP6UXfuY
transaction
80f933727cae37a57fd25cb62a456289a39e4a3cfcd876a8c78a89f6f2d15736
confirmations
372176
spent
true